OPERATION
When the height sensor or headlight leveling unit is abnormal,
the headlight automatic leveling warning is displayed.
COMMENTS ON TROUBLE SYMPTOM
If the headlight automatic leveling warning is not displayed, the
combination meter, headlight automatic leveling-ECU, or the
harness and connector(s) between the two may have a problem.
TECHNICAL DESCRIPTION (COMMENT)
⦆
Malfunction of the headlight automatic leveling-ECU
⦆
Malfunction of combination meter
⦆
The wiring harness or connectors may have loose, corroded,
or damaged terminals, or terminals pushed back in the
connector
DIAGNOSIS
Required Special Tools:
⦆
MB991958: Scan Tool (M.U.T.-III Sub Assembly)
⦆
MB991824: Vehicle Communication Interface (V.C.I.)
⦆
MB991827: M.U.T.-III USB Cable
⦆
MB991910: M.U.T.-III Main Harness A (Vehicles with
CAN communication system)
STEP 1. Check of automatic leveling.
Check that the automatic leveling operates normally.
Q:Is the check result normal?

YES:
Go to Step 2.
NO:
Refer to Inspection Procedure 2 "Neither right nor
left automatic leveling operates." P.54Ac-84.
STEP 2. Using scan tool MB991958, check other system
actuator test.
Perform the actuator test for the combination meter, and check
that the headlight automatic leveling warning is displayed .

To prevent damage to scan tool MB991958, always turn the
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position before
connecting or disconnecting scan tool MB991958.
(1)
Connect scan tool MB991958. Refer to "How to connect scan
tool (M.U.T.-III) P.54Ac-58."
(2)
Connect scan tool MB991958 to the data link connector.
(3)
Turn the ignition switch to the "ON" position.
(4)
Set scan tool MB991958 to the actuator test mode.
⦆
Item 8: Indicator2
(5)
Tur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position.
Q:Is the check result normal?
YES:
Go to Step 3.
NO:
Replace the combination meter.
STEP 3. Check combination meter connector C-03,
headlight automatic leveling-ECU connector C-110 for
loose, corroded or damaged terminals, or terminals pushed
back in the connector.
Q:Is combination meter connector C-03, headlight
automatic leveling-ECU connector C-110 in good
condition?
YES:
Go to Step 4.
NO:
Repair the damaged parts.
STEP 4. Check wiring harness between combination meter
connector C-03 (terminal No. 6/20) and the headlight
automatic leveling-ECU connector C-110 (terminal No. 8/9).
NOTE:
Prior to the wiring harness inspection, check
intermediate connector C-34, and repair if necessary.
Q:Are the wiring harness between combination meter
connector C-03 (terminal No. 6/20) and the headlight
automatic leveling-ECU connector C-110 (terminal No.
8/9) in good condition?
YES:
Go to Step 5.
NO:
Repair the wiring harness.
STEP 5. Retest the system
Check that the headlight automatic leveling warning display is
illuminated under the illumination conditions.

Q:Is the check result normal?
YES:
The trouble can be an intermittent malfunction
(Refer to GROUP 00 - How to use Troubleshooting/
inspection Service Points - How to Cope with Intermittent
Malfunction P.00-15).
NO:
Replace the headlight automatic leveling-ECU.
Inspection Procedure 5: The headlight automatic leveling warning light does not go off.
M15410900111USA0000010000
Before replacing the ECU, ensure that the power supply
circuit, the ground circuit and the communication circuit are
normal.
TECHNICAL DESCRIPTION (COMMENT)
If the headlight automatic leveling warning display does not go
off, DTC may be set, or the automatic leveling ECU or the
combination meter may have a problem.
TROUBLESHOOTING HINTS
⦆
Diagnostic trouble code setting is under way.
⦆
Malfunction of the headlight automatic leveling-ECU
⦆
Malfunction of combination meter
⦆
The wiring harness or connectors may have loose, corroded,
or damaged terminals, or terminals pushed back in the
connector
